Old Mrs. Xu's ten-ingredient tonic pills weren't for nothing; she wouldn't be able to vent her anger until she beat this clueless daughter into submission.
Grandma Chen, always eager for drama, exclaimed, "Qiu, it's not that I don't want to speak up for you, but what you did today was really unfair. No wonder your mother is so angry."
Grandma Xu really hit her, and Wang Juan was terrified. She had always known that Grandma Xu doted on her sister-in-law. Ever since her sister-in-law married into the family, Grandma Xu had given them many gifts. So she thought that with her sister-in-law's intervention, the matter would be resolved. She never expected that Grandma Xu would be so terrifying when she got angry. She hadn't seen anyone hit someone so fiercely in years.
Xu Qiuju's husband, Wang Zhongjun, was unaware that she had brought her sister-in-law back to her parents' home. He only found out when he got home from get off work, and then he realized he was in trouble.
He had heard his mother and sister talk about his younger sister's crush on a young educated youth from Xujia Village quite often. Later, he learned that the young educated youth was no ordinary person and was even living in the Xu family's home.
Wang Zhongjun had always known that his younger sister was ambitious and that the people she set her sights on were not ordinary. In fact, Wang Zhongjun did not think highly of his sister. If she looked like Xu Xinning, he would think she was perfect, but she looked like his sister and was always thinking about these unrealistic things. What a load of crap!
To marry well, one either needs to be good-looking, have a good job, or come from a good family. But what does her sister have? She's a complete loser.
When Wang Zhongjun rushed to Xujia Village, he saw Old Mrs. Xu chasing Xu Qiuju with a large broom, while his good-for-nothing sister hid in the corner. Old Mrs. Chen sat on the wall, constantly nagging. Two young people, a boy and a girl, sat at the entrance of the main room, watching the commotion with their chins in their hands. Many villagers stood at the gate watching the excitement.
Wang Zhongjun felt like he wanted to escape. He thought that if he went in now, it would be a small matter if his mother-in-law beat and scolded him, but it would be a big problem if the Xu family rejected him. After all, his current position was related to Xu Yaozu's influence. If he didn't have such a powerful brother-in-law, would he have been able to sit in the position of director?
Wang Zhongjun is a very self-aware person, which is why even though his mother always complained that Xu Qiuju had given birth to two daughters, he always acted as a peacemaker at home.
Old Mrs. Chen had sharp eyes and was sitting high up, so she spotted Wang Zhongjun hesitating at the gate at a glance. Old Mrs. Chen called out at the top of her lungs, "Qiu! Your Zhongjun is here."
Upon hearing that her brother had arrived, Wang Juan seemed to find solace and dashed from the corner to the front gate. Seeing Wang Zhongjun, she burst into tears.
Wang Juan: "Brother, you've finally arrived! The Xu family is so unreasonable; they're all uncivilized country bumpkins. Don't ever come to the Xu family again."
Wang Zhongjun was furious!
What kind of talk is that? Doesn't he know what kind of temper his mother-in-law has? She's an extremely gentle old lady; she wouldn't chase after someone to beat them unless she was really angry.
Wang Zhongjun's face turned red with anger, and he roared at Wang Juan, "Shut up! Don't you know what you've done?"
Wang Zhongjun was also angry at his wife's muddle-headed nature. With such a strong support system and his own job, why couldn't she stand up for herself? Her personality made being her husband quite difficult. Every time he reasoned with her, a few words from his mother and sister the next day would make her lose her mind again. Sometimes she would even bring up things he had said to her without thinking, putting him in an awkward position. Then he would have to save the day and smooth things over, which was really exhausting.
Wang Juan couldn't help but burst into tears after being yelled at by Wang Zhongjun.
Grandma Xu heard the noise and stopped hitting Xu Qiuju.
The old lady was panting, and her meticulously styled hair was disheveled.
This was the second time Xu Xinning had seen Grandma Xu in such a disheveled state.
Children are all debts!
Both of Mrs. Xu's embarrassing moments were related to her children.
Mu Jingheng fawned over Old Madam Xu, pouring her a glass of water and handing it to her with a grin, saying, "Grandma, I'm sorry you had to go through all this trouble for me. Drink this water, and I'll give you a massage later. I promise you'll feel great."
This person was good-looking and had a silver tongue; Old Mrs. Xu's anger dissipated almost completely in an instant.
Grandma Xu drank the water heartily, gulping it down in large gulps.
Mu Jingheng took the cup, pulled Grandma Xu to sit down, and then started massaging her.
Grandma Xu let out a comfortable sigh.
Xu Xinning found it amusing; Mu Jingheng was truly a master of deception, capable of utterly ruthless and deceitful behavior.
Wang Zhongjun felt that whether he stuck his neck out or not, he would still get stabbed, so he gritted his teeth and went into the yard.
Xu Qiuju, her face covered in dust and her eyes red, went to greet him as if she had suffered a great injustice. "Her father, you're here."
Wang Zhongjun glanced at her, feeling both annoyed and heartbroken.
His wife, aside from her cluelessness, is otherwise impeccable. Many people in the factory envied him for marrying her. She was the factory's most beautiful girl; quite a few had their eyes on her. If he hadn't been so persistent, how could such a pretty girl have fallen for a man like him who had no advantages whatsoever?
Wang Zhongjun couldn't harden his heart no matter what. He lovingly stroked her hair and strode towards Old Mrs. Xu.
Grandma Xu was enjoying Mu Jingheng's massage service with her eyes closed.
Wang Zhongjun leaned closer and called out, "Mother."
Grandma Xu deliberately ignored him.
Xu Xinning stood up and brought Wang Zhongjun a stool to sit on, then poured him a glass of water. Judging from his appearance, he must have rushed over in a great hurry.
Wang Zhongjun wasn't angry that Old Mrs. Xu ignored him; after all, they were the ones in the wrong. Even if that weren't the case, what was wrong with flattering his mother-in-law a little more?
